Summary:
Carnitine is an amino acid that the body makes, uses and modifies as part of a healthy metabolism. L-Carnitine is a supplement typically used to improve cognition, elevate depression and improve exercise performance.
Acetyl-L-carnitine is a similar compound to L-Carnitine with the main difference being that it uses an acetyl group that connects to the carnitine using an oxygen molecule, and reported to be more effective at crossing the blood-brain barrier.
